MGV 835A is a 1974 MG B GT V8 in Blue with a 3,528c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 1974 MG B GT V8 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.0% with a typical mileage of 54,938 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G B GT V8 fails its MOT is wind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id, accounting for 160 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MGV 835A,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G B GT V8 typically stays on UK roads for around 55 years. At 52 years old, this MG B GT V8 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
